Gestational diabetes is a condition that affects pregnant women, leading to high blood sugar levels. It is essential to take proactive steps to avoid the development of gestational diabetes for the well-being of both the mother and the baby. Here are eight tips that can help expectant mothers stay healthy and reduce the risk of gestational diabetes:

Eat a Well-Balanced Diet

Proper nutrition is crucial during pregnancy, especially when it comes to preventing gestational diabetes. Focus on consuming a well-balanced diet that includes a vari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ats. Avoid excessive consumption of processed foods and sugary snacks.

Stay Active

Regular physical activity is beneficial for pregnant women to maintain a healthy body weight and prevent gestational diabetes. Engage in activities like walking, swimming, prenatal yoga, or low-impact aerobics after consulting with your healthcare provider. Aim for at least 30 minutes of exercise most days of the week.

Maintain a Healthy Weight

Being overweight or obese increases the risk of developing gestational diabetes. Speak with your doctor about the appropriate weight gain during pregnancy based on your pre-pregnancy BMI. Strive to stay within the recommended weight range by following a healthy diet and staying active.

Monitor Carbohydrate Intake

Carbohydrates have a direct impact on blood sugar levels. Limit your consumption of refined carbohydrates, such as white bread, pasta, and sugary beverages. Opt for complex carbohydrates like whole grains, legumes, and vegetables, which are digested more slowly and have a lesser impact on blood sugar.

Avoid Sugary Drinks

Drinking sugary beverages can rapidly increase blood sugar levels. It is best to avoid sodas, sweetened juices, energy drinks, and other sugary drinks. Instead, stay hydrated by consuming water, unsweetened herbal tea, or infusing water with fruits for a refreshing twist.

Practice Portion Control

Eating appropriate portion sizes helps regulate blood sugar levels. Be mindful of your serving sizes and aim for balanced meals. Include a mix of proteins, healthy fats, and carbohydrates in each meal, ensuring that you are not overeating any particular food group.

Ensure Sufficient Fiber Intake

Fiber aids in maintaining stable blood sugar levels and promoting good digestion. Include foods rich in fiber, such as whole grains, fruits, vegetables, and legumes, in your diet. These foods not only help prevent gestational diabetes but also provide essential nutrients.

Get Regular Check-ups

Regular prenatal check-ups are crucial for monitoring your overall health and detecting any signs of gestational diabetes. Your healthcare provider will perform blood sugar level screenings as part of routine prenatal care. Early detection allows for timely intervention if gestational diabetes is detected.

By following these tips, expectant mothers can reduce their risk of developing gestational diabetes and promote a healthy pregnancy. Remember to consult with your healthcare provider for personalized advice and guidance based on your specific needs and medical history.
